Senior Hardware/Software ML Inference IP and Compiler Developer

1 week ago


Toronto, Ontario, Canada Altera Full time

Job Details
Job Description:
Senior Hardware/Software ML Inference IP and Compiler Developer
Altera is one of the world's leading providers of programmable solutions. With a renewed focus on agility and software-first useability, Altera is shaping the future of computing by providing flexible technology, empowering innovators with scalable products, from high-performance to power- and cost-optimized devices for cloud, network, and edge applications. Join Altera's FPGA AI Suite team to create, build, and deliver our future FPGA technology

As a Senior Engineer, you have experience with hardware, software, and machine learning inference. You are comfortable sharing your knowledge and expertise to help push the overall team to greater heights. You enjoy thinking about how best to execute ML inference on hardware, and how to co-optimize that with the software compiler; you have the ability to drive architectural exploration to fully understand and defend the optimization trade-offs. You are comfortable and enjoy navigating both the software and hardware realms to co-optimize the soft IP and compiler for ML inference. You like to work collaboratively and drive these ideas in a small team, located in prime Toronto location at the corner of Bloor and Avenue.

Our compensation is designed to reflect the Canadian labour market. The actual salary offered may vary based on several factors, including the position's location, as well as the candidate's experience, skills, training, and job-specific knowledge. In addition to base salary, we offer performance-based incentive opportunities that reward both individual contributions and overall company success.

Estimated Salary Range: $139.0k – $201.2k CAD

We use artificial intelligence to screen, assess, or select applicants for the position. This posting is for an existing vacancy. Canadian work experience is not required for this role.

Qualifications
Minimum Qualifications

  • Undergraduate or greater degree in Electrical Engineering or a related field
  • 10+ years of industry experience, including software development, hardware development, and an understanding of the nuts and bolts of machine learning inference
  • The ideal candidate will have experience using FPGAs and writing soft IP for them

Job Type
Regular

Shift
Shift 1 (Canada)

Primary Location:
Toronto, Ontario, Canada

Additional Locations:
Posting Statement
All qualified applicants will receive consideration for employment without regard to race, color, religion, religious creed, sex, national origin, ancestry, age, physical or mental disability, medical condition, genetic information, military and veteran status, marital status, pregnancy, gender, gender expression, gender identity, sexual orientation, or any other characteristic protected by local law, regulation, or ordinance.



  • Toronto, Ontario, Canada d-Matrix Full time

    At d-Matrix, we are focused on unleashing the potential of generative AI to power the transformation of technology. We are at the forefront of software and hardware innovation, pushing the boundaries of what is possible. Our culture is one of respect and collaboration.We value humility and believe in direct communication. Our team is inclusive, and our...


  • Toronto, Ontario, Canada Amazon Web Services (AWS) Full time

    DescriptionAt AWS our vision is to make deep learning pervasive for everyday developers and to democratize access to innovative infrastructure. In order to deliver on that vision, we've created innovative software and hardware solutions that make it possible.AWS Neuron is the SDK that optimizes the performance of complex neural net models executed on AWS...


  • Toronto, Ontario, Canada Amazon Web Services (AWS) Full time

    *DESCRIPTION*The Product: AWS Machine Learning accelerators are at the forefront of AWS innovation. The Inferentia chip delivers best-in-class ML inference performance at the lowest cost in the cloud. Trainium will deliver the best-in-class ML training performance with the most teraflops (TFLOPS) of compute power for ML in the cloud. This is all enabled by a...


  • Toronto, Ontario, Canada Tenstorrent University Jobs Full time

    Tenstorrent is leading the industry on cutting-edge AI technology, revolutionizing performance expectations, ease of use, and cost efficiency. With AI redefining the computing paradigm, solutions must evolve to unify innovations in software models, compilers, platforms, networking, and semiconductors. Our diverse team of technologists have developed a high...


  • Toronto, Ontario, Canada Cerebras Systems Full time

    Cerebras Systems builds the world's largest AI chip, 56 times larger than GPUs. Our novel wafer-scale architecture provides the AI compute power of dozens of GPUs on a single chip, with the programming simplicity of a single device. This approach allows Cerebras to deliver industry-leading training and inference speeds and empowers machine learning users to...


  • Toronto, Ontario, Canada Cerebras Full time

    Cerebras Systems builds the world's largest AI chip, 56 times larger than GPUs. Our novel wafer-scale architecture provides the AI compute power of dozens of GPUs on a single chip, with the programming simplicity of a single device. This approach allows Cerebras to deliver industry-leading training and inference speeds and empowers machine learning users to...


  • Toronto, Ontario, Canada BenchSci Full time

    We are looking for a Senior Product Manager to join our growing Product Management team. This is a challenging, highly strategic position that sits at the critical intersection of our predictive AI engine, external strategic partners, and internal product lines. You will act as the custodian of our core inference and prediction technology, balancing its...


  • Toronto, Ontario, Canada BenchSci Full time

    We are looking for a Senior Product Manager to join our growing Product Management team.This is a challenging, highly strategic position that sits at the critical intersection of ourpredictive AI engine, external strategic partners, and internal product lines.You will act as the custodian of our core inference and prediction technology, balancing...


  • Toronto, Ontario, Canada BenchSci Full time

    We are looking for a Senior Product Manager to join our growing Product Management team. This is a challenging, highly strategic position that sits at the critical intersection of our predictive AI engine, external strategic partners, and internal product lines. You will act as the custodian of our core inference and prediction technology, balancing its...


  • Toronto, Ontario, Canada BenchSci Full time

    We are looking for a Senior Product Manager to join our growing Product Management team.This is a challenging, highly strategic position that sits at the critical intersection of ourpredictive AI engine, external strategic partners, and internal product lines.You will act as the custodian of our core inference and prediction technology, balancing...